Engineered siding installation services involve attaching manufactured siding materials designed to enhance the durability and appearance of a property's exterior. These services typically include preparing the existing surface, measuring and cutting the siding to fit, and securely installing the panels to ensure a seamless and long-lasting finish. Professional installers often work with a variety of engineered materials, ensuring proper alignment and fastening techniques to maximize the siding's effectiveness and visual appeal.
This type of siding installation addresses common exterior problems such as moisture infiltration, wood rot, and damage caused by pests or weather. Engineered siding is often chosen for its resistance to warping, cracking, and insect infestation, making it a practical solution for properties prone to such issues. Proper installation helps improve a building’s weather resistance, reduce maintenance needs, and extend the lifespan of the exterior surface, ultimately protecting the underlying structure and reducing long-term repair costs.

Material Costs - Engineered siding installation typically ranges from $3 to $7 per square foot for materials, with premium options reaching up to $10 per square foot. The total cost depends on the chosen product and project size.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ing engineered siding gener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. Larger or more complex projects may incur higher labor fees due to additional work.
Project Size Impact - Smaller installations may cost around $1,500, while larger projects can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. The overall expense varies based on the home's size and siding complexity.
Additional Fees - Costs for prep work, such as removing old siding or repairs, can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. These extras depend on the existing condition of the surface and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of engineered siding are available for installation? Local siding professionals can install various types of engineered siding, including fiber cement, engineered wood, and composite materials, to suit different aesthetic and durability preferences.
How long does an engineered siding installation typically take? The duration of installation depends on the size of the project and the type of siding chosen; contacting local pros can provide a more specific timeframe based on individual needs.
What are the benefits of choosing engineered siding over traditional materials? Engineered siding offers benefits such as enhanced durability, resistance to pests and weather, and a variety of styles, making it a popular alternative to traditional wood or vinyl siding.
Is engineered siding suitable for all types of buildings? Engineered siding is versatile and can be installed on residential and commercial structures, but consulting with local professionals can determine the best options for specific building types.
What maintenance is required for engineered siding after installation? Maintenance requirements vary by material, but generally include regular cleaning and inspections; local siding experts can provide tailored advice for ongoing care.
